Let's leave Manhattan behind and head to upstate New York, where we'll visit the beautiful Catskills house of a law professor and his filmmaker wife....

The house boasts four bedrooms and two full bathrooms, spread out over almost 2,000 square feet. It sits on almost two acres of land (which is impressive!). For fellow artsy types, there’s an exterior workshop or shed where you can, you know, make stuff.

The asking price for all this? An altogether reasonable-sounding $345,000, the price of a small studio back in Manhattan.
